  • New Plusminuszero Collection

    The Naoto Fukasawa-designed Plusminuszero brand has launched a new collection. It includes a coffee and tea maker, toaster, container, sliced bread dish, mug, calculators in 2 sizes, a new version of the humidifer, and a heater.

  • PingMag: Ken Okuyama

    PingMag interviews designer Ken Okuyama — he of the Pininfarina carbon fibre bodies — from Milan’s Tokyo Design Premio, held back in April.
